姓名:孫曉波
職稱:副教授
聯系電話:
電子郵箱:sunxb@buaa.edu.cn
辦公地址:沙河校區實驗7号樓814
教育背景
1994.9-1998.7 吉林大學,材料科學與工程系,大學本科
1998.9-2001.7 吉林大學,材料科學與工程系,碩士研究生
2002.9-2006.1 中國科學院化學研究所,有機固體,博士研究生
工作履曆
2006.2-2006.10 中國科學院化學研究所,助理研究員
2006.11-2011.12 美國加州大學河濱分校博士後
2012.01-至今 beat365英国官网网站化學與環境學院 副教授
研究領域
1.有機太陽能電池材料與器件
2.石墨烯納米複合材料的結構與性能
學術成果
到目前為止發表SCI論文40餘篇,相關工作他引1200餘次,其中第一作者或通訊作者代表論文:
